CABARRUS COUNTY <br />BOARDS, COMMITTEES, COMMISSIONS AND AUTHORITIES <br />The Cabarrus County Board of Commissioners makes appointments to a number <br />of boards, committees, commissions and authorities. All citizens of Cabarrus <br />County are encouraged to volunteer to serve on these boards /committees. The application may also be downloaded <br />from the County's website at www.cabarruscounty.us <br />A listing of the boards /committees is as follows: <br />ACTIVE LIVING AND PARKS COMMISSION <br />This commission advises on parks and recreation needs of County <br />residents and assists the Parks Department in planning facilities and <br />operational activities. The 11- member commission includes a <br />representative from each of the 7 planning areas (Concord, Eastern, <br />Kannapolis, Central, Midland, Northwest Cabarrus and Harrisburg), 2 at- <br />large representatives, 1 representative from the Cabarrus School Board <br />and 1 representative from the Kannapolis School Board. Appointments <br />are for terms of three years. <br />ADULT CARE HOME COMMUNITY ADVISORY COMMITTEE <br />This committee seeks to maintain the intent of the Adult Care Home <br />Residents Bill of Rights and to promote community involvement with the <br />homes (homes for the aged, family care homes and homes for <br />developmentally disabled adults). Members cannot be employed by an <br />adult care home nor have any financial interest, directly or indirectly, in an <br />adult care home. Immediate family of an adult care home resident in <br />Cabarrus County cannot serve on the committee. Initial appointment is for <br />a term of one year with successive appointments of three -year terms. <br />CONCORD PLANNING AND ZONING COMMISSION <br />The Commission guides, reviews and regulates land developments within <br />and around the boundaries of the City of Concord. The County <br />Commissioners appoint one member who resides in Concord's <br />extraterritorial jurisdiction area for a term of three years. <br />HUMAN SERVICES ADVISORY BOARD <br />This board is appointed by the Board of Commissioners to advocate, <br />advise and consult regarding services within the Department of Human <br />Services. The board is composed of five members who are appointed for <br />three -year terms. <br />Attachment number 1 \n <br />1 -7 Page 194 <br />
